Main duties of the job

Responsibilities of the role include but are not limited to the following:

  • Participate in vaccination and immunisation programmes for both adults and children - including vaccinations for those travelling abroad.
  • Provide wound care (ulcer / Doppler etc.) to patients.
  • Taking patient samples, swabs, blood, specimens, and checking pulse, temperature and blood pressure.
  • To support and advise women requesting information relating to family planning needs and those presenting for cervical cytology consultations.
  • Giving advice, education and information about chronic health conditions and ailments, smoking cessation and losing weight.
  • Documenting all patient contacts in the electronic patient record.
  • Ensure all training is up to date.

About us

We are growing our clinical and non-clinical teams to wrap additional support around our GP practices. With mental health nurses/assistants, dietetics, social prescribing, frailty liaison and enhanced Care Home support, on-site pharmacy; paramedic homebound support, first contact physiotherapy and some brilliant community partners across our patch, we are excited to see that by reducing red tape and working in a truly multi-disciplinary way, we are reducing GP workload while improving outcomes for our patients. We believe strongly that diversity of background, thought and experience across Pier Health leads to better outcomes for our patients and more positive employee experiences and we are actively working towards this. Physical Effort

Prolonged periods of time spent in a sitting position at a computer screen in putting information and making telephone calls. The post holder is occasionally required to lift equipment several times throughout the week e.g., files, boxes, or stationery.

Mental Effort

Prioritising work is essential, as often many tasks are required to be undertaken simultaneously. The post holder is required to work under pressure to meet deadlines.

Emotional Effort

Potential for distressing situations when liaising with vulnerable groups and their families/carers.

Working Conditions

You would be required to work in several different environments across the Primary Care Network.

Training and Development

All roles within Pier Xtra have an element of statutory mandatory e-learning training which will be completed within the first two weeks of employment. Any extra training required for role developed will be provided as required.
